C&C++   发布时间:2022-04-03  发布网站:大佬教程  code.js-code.com
大佬教程收集整理的这篇文章主要介绍了将c#datatype转换为等效的java数据类型大佬教程大佬觉得挺不错的,现在分享给大家,也给大家做个参考。
我在C#中使用的数据类型很少,我需要转换为 Java.

uint,Int16,UInt16,Nullable< Int16>

Java中这些适当的数据类型是什么?

解决方法

尽管x2提供的链接很好,但在处理无符号原语时并不是那么有用.例如:int的范围是2,147,483,648到2,647(在两种语言中都是相同的),但C#s uint的范围是0到4,294,967,295. Java没有类似的原始类型,因此您必须使用包含该范围的内容(在本例中为long).

如果您只担心单向兼容性(C#到Java),这些应该可以工作:

> c# – > java的
> uint – >长
> Int16 – >短
> UInt16 – >短
> Nullable – >查看包装基本类型的类(即Integer包装int)

编辑::
我刚发现this article on MSDN about the differences between the data types in the two languages.

大佬总结

以上是大佬教程为你收集整理的将c#datatype转换为等效的java数据类型全部内容,希望文章能够帮你解决将c#datatype转换为等效的java数据类型所遇到的程序开发问题。

如果觉得大佬教程网站内容还不错,欢迎将大佬教程推荐给程序员好友。

本图文内容来源于网友网络收集整理提供,作为学习参考使用,版权属于原作者。
如您有任何意见或建议可联系处理。小编QQ:384754419,请注明来意。